Moore is playing the role of Laurel Hester in the film, a New Jersey police detective, who was prevented by government officials from assigning her pension benefits to her partner Stacie Andree after she fell terminally ill, reported The Hollywood Reporter.
Galifianakis will play the role of Garden State Equality activist Steven Goldstein.
Peter Sollett will direct from a screenplay by Ron Nyswaner.
The role of Dane Wells, Hester's detective colleague is yet to be cast. Wells became the leader in the fight for the same-sex couple's rights after learning of Hester's orientation.
